Multi Vendor Marketplace Plugin | WCFM Marketplace › Forums › WCFM – Marketplace (WooCommerce Multivendor Marketplace) › Strip split payments
Tagged: stripe
- This topic has 17 replies, 3 voices, and was last updated 4 years, 6 months ago by L Stewart.
- AuthorPosts
- April 22, 2020 at 3:42 am #121565L StewartParticipant
Hi,
I have set up stripe split payments and done many tests.
But the payment in stripe is not being sent to the connected account. - April 22, 2020 at 1:40 pm #121685SushobhanKeymaster
Hello,
Are you using any other Stripe plugin in your site except WCFM Stripe Split pay?
Please show me screenshot from WCFM Admin Setting -> Payment Setting
Please check at wp-admin -> WooCommerce -> Status -> Logs -> wcfm-stripe log -> is any error generated?Thanks You!
- April 23, 2020 at 3:07 am #122005L StewartParticipantThis reply has been marked as private.
- April 23, 2020 at 3:09 pm #122152L StewartParticipantThis reply has been marked as private.
- April 23, 2020 at 3:26 pm #122165SushobhanKeymaster
Hello,
As I can see from the log, there is nothing wrong with your stripe payments. You are using Stripe in test mode. So it’s not getting reflected in your stripe account. You can make a transaction in live mode with minimum amount to confirm this.
Thanks! - April 30, 2020 at 3:22 am #124870paul-8288Participant
Did you get this working? I have the same problem, if I enable 3D secure then the connected account get no payment, if I disable 3D then it works fine and the connected account gets its payment. This is in test mode, the connected accounts should still show the transaction being transferred in test mode. Its only when 3D is enabled it doesn’t work properly, money is then not transferrable for 7 days because the connected accounts/accounts are not flagged in the API.
- April 30, 2020 at 4:55 am #124884L StewartParticipant
@paul-8288 no I haven’t looked much further into this. I just tested using a non secure card and the split payment did work. So it looks like you’re right – it’s something to do with the 3D secure payment.
I think I’ll need to do a live test.
- April 30, 2020 at 5:14 am #124891
- April 30, 2020 at 5:57 pm #125050paul-8288Participant
You probably have test data switched on in WCFM payment settings, dont forget to update the keys with the ones from your live stripe settings. Also from that screenshot it looks like your creating express or custom accounts in stripe, if you want standard accounts, have a look at the fix I posted here
https://wclovers.com/forums/topic/connect-vendors-to-stripe/If you want to carry on testing, try using it with this card number, in test mode this forces it to use a 3D secure card and where it keeps failing for me.
4000000000003220.But if you get it setup live, let me know.
- May 1, 2020 at 4:32 pm #125388
- May 1, 2020 at 5:34 pm #125409paul-8288Participant
Can you post a screentshot with the client id partially hidden of your stripe settings in WCFM and also your stripe connect settings? In stripe goto settings at the bottom, and then click on connect settings, it should take you to this page
https://dashboard.stripe.com/settings/applications - May 1, 2020 at 5:35 pm #125410paul-8288Participant
Sorry should have said, that error basically means you havent input the 2 redirect urls in stripe settings. Dont forget live and test are different keys/ids.
- May 1, 2020 at 5:43 pm #125416L StewartParticipant
thanks @paul-8288. I have both the live and test keys/client ID’s setup.
But turns out I only have the redirects set up for test environment. So i’ll add these URLS into the live environment now. Thank you! Feel like an idiot.
Though I’ll probably be back here again with another question.
- May 1, 2020 at 6:02 pm #125422paul-8288Participant
ha ha no worries, self interest, I want to see how the 3D card works in a live env and if the client gets the split pay or not.
- May 5, 2020 at 1:02 am #126698
- May 8, 2020 at 4:42 pm #128390L StewartParticipant
@paul-8288 I did a live test with my personal card which I believe is 3D secure. But it didn’t actually ask me for any additional checks. I am not a developer – but I think it’s got something to do with Stripe 3D secure check being set as ‘optional’ – I assume it makes an evaluation of the risk level ?
No idea. But the payment went through fine and the split payment work. Not sure this helps at all.
- AuthorPosts
- You must be logged in to reply to this topic.